  1. /*
  2. * Copyright (c) 2013-2015 the CivetWeb developers
  3. * Copyright (c) 2013 No Face Press, LLC
  4. * License http://opensource.org/licenses/mit-license.php MIT License
  5. */
  6. /* Simple example program on how to use CivetWeb embedded into a C program. */
  7. #ifdef _WIN32
  8. #include <Windows.h>
  9. #else
  10. #include <unistd.h>
  11. #endif
  12. #include <stdlib.h>
  13. #include <string.h>
  14. #include "civetweb.h"
  15. #define DOCUMENT_ROOT "."
  16. #ifdef NO_SSL
  17. #ifdef USE_IPV6
  18. #define PORT "[::]:8888"
  19. #else
  20. #define PORT "8888"
  21. #endif
  22. #else
  23. #ifdef USE_IPV6
  24. #define PORT "[::]:8888r,[::]:8843s,8884"
  25. #else
  26. #define PORT "8888r,8843s"
  27. #endif
  28. #endif
  29. #define EXAMPLE_URI "/example"
  30. #define EXIT_URI "/exit"
  31. int exitNow = 0;
  32. int
  33. ExampleH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  34. {
  35.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  36. mg_printf(conn, "<html><body>");
  37. mg_printf(conn, "<h2>This is an example text from a C handler</h2>");
  38. mg_printf(
  39. conn,
  40. "<p>To see a page from the A handler <a href=\"A\">click A</a></p>");
  41. mg_printf(conn,
  42. "<p>To see a page from the A handler <a href=\"A/A\">click "
  43. "A/A</a></p>");
  44. mg_printf(conn,
  45. "<p>To see a page from the A/B handler <a "
  46. "href=\"A/B\">click A/B</a></p>");
  47. mg_printf(conn,
  48. "<p>To see a page from the B handler (0) <a "
  49. "href=\"B\">click B</a></p>");
  50. mg_printf(conn,
  51. "<p>To see a page from the B handler (1) <a "
  52. "href=\"B/A\">click B/A</a></p>");
  53. mg_printf(conn,
  54. "<p>To see a page from the B handler (2) <a "
  55. "href=\"B/B\">click B/B</a></p>");
  56. mg_printf(conn,
  57. "<p>To see a page from the *.foo handler <a "
  58. "href=\"xy.foo\">click xy.foo</a></p>");
  59. mg_printf(conn,
  60. "<p>To see a page from the FileHandler handler <a "
  61. "href=\"form\">click form</a> (this is the form test page)</p>");
  62.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  63. mg_printf(conn,
  64. "<p>To test websocket handler <a href=\"/websocket\">click "
  65. "websocket</a></p>");
  66. #endif
  67. mg_printf(conn, "<p>To exit <a href=\"%s\">click exit</a></p>", EXIT_URI);
  68. mg_printf(conn, "</body></html>\n");
  69. return 1;
  70. }
  71. int
  72. ExitH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  73. {
  74.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/plain\r\n\r\n");
  75. mg_printf(conn, "Server will shut down.\n");
  76. mg_printf(conn, "Bye!\n");
  77. exitNow = 1;
  78. return 1;
  79. }
  80. int
  81. AH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  82. {
  83.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  84. mg_printf(conn, "<html><body>");
  85. mg_printf(conn, "<h2>This is the A handler!!!</h2>");
  86. mg_printf(conn, "</body></html>\n");
  87. return 1;
  88. }
  89. int
  90. ABH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  91. {
  92.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  93. mg_printf(conn, "<html><body>");
  94. mg_printf(conn, "<h2>This is the AB handler!!!</h2>");
  95. mg_printf(conn, "</body></html>\n");
  96. return 1;
  97. }
  98. int
  99. BXH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  100. {
  101. /* Handler may access the request info using mg_get_request_info */
  102. const struct mg_request_info *req_info = mg_get_request_info(conn);
  103.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  104. mg_printf(conn, "<html><body>");
  105. mg_printf(conn, "<h2>This is the BX handler %p!!!</h2>", cbdata);
  106. mg_printf(conn, "<p>The actual uri is %s</p>", req_info->uri);
  107. mg_printf(conn, "</body></html>\n");
  108. return 1;
  109. }
  110. int
  111. FooH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  112. {
  113. /* Handler may access the request info using mg_get_request_info */
  114. const struct mg_request_info *req_info = mg_get_request_info(conn);
  115.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  116. mg_printf(conn, "<html><body>");
  117. mg_printf(conn, "<h2>This is the Foo handler!!!</h2>");
  118. mg_printf(conn,
  119. "<p>The request was:<br><pre>%s %s HTTP/%s</pre></p>",
  120. req_info->request_method,
  121. req_info->uri,
  122. req_info->http_version);
  123. mg_printf(conn, "</body></html>\n");
  124. return 1;
  125. }
  126. int
  127. FileH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  128. {
  129. /* In this handler, we ignore the req_info and send the file "fileName". */
  130. const char *fileName = (const char *)cbdata;
  131. mg_send_file(conn, fileName);
  132. return 1;
  133. }
  134. struct mg_form_data_handler {
  135. int (*field_found)(const char *key,
  136. size_t keylen,
  137. const char *value,
  138. size_t vallen,
  139. void *user_data);
  140. int (*file_found)(const char *key,
  141. size_t keylen,
  142. const char *filename,
  143. int *disposition,
  144. void *user_data);
  145. void *user_data;
  146. };
  147. int
  148. field_found(const char *key,
  149. size_t keylen,
  150. const char *value,
  151. size_t vallen,
  152. void *user_data)
  153. {
  154. return 0;
  155. }
  156. int
  157. FormH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  158. {
  159. /* Handler may access the request info using mg_get_request_info */
  160. const struct mg_request_info *req_info = mg_get_request_info(conn);
  161. int ret;
  162. struct mg_form_data_handler fdh = {field_found, 0, 0};
  163. /* TODO: Checks before calling handle_form_data ? */
  164. (void)req_info;
  165. /* TODO: Handle the return value */
  166. ret = mg_handle_form_data(conn, &fdh);
  167. return 1;
  168. }
  169. int
  170. WebSocketStartH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  171. {
  172. mg_printf(conn, "HTTP/1.1 200 OK\r\nContent-Type: text/html\r\n\r\n");
  173. mg_printf(conn, "<!DOCTYPE html>\n");
  174. mg_printf(conn, "<html>\n<head>\n");
  175. mg_printf(conn, "<meta charset=\"UTF-8\">\n");
  176. mg_printf(conn, "<title>Embedded websocket example</title>\n");
  177.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  178. /* mg_printf(conn, "<script type=\"text/javascript\"><![CDATA[\n"); ...
  179. * xhtml style */
  180. mg_printf(conn, "<script>\n");
  181. mg_printf(
  182. conn,
  183. "function load() {\n"
  184. " var wsproto = (location.protocol === 'https:') ? 'wss:' : 'ws:';\n"
  185. " connection = new WebSocket(wsproto + '//' + window.location.host + "
  186. "'/websocket');\n"
  187. " websock_text_field = "
  188. "document.getElementById('websock_text_field');\n"
  189. " connection.onmessage = function (e) {\n"
  190. " websock_text_field.innerHTML=e.data;\n"
  191. " }\n"
  192. " connection.onerror = function (error) {\n"
  193. " alert('WebSocket error');\n"
  194. " connection.close();\n"
  195. " }\n"
  196. "}\n");
  197. /* mg_printf(conn, "]]></script>\n"); ... xhtml style */
  198. mg_printf(conn, "</script>\n");
  199. mg_printf(conn, "</head>\n<body onload=\"load()\">\n");
  200. mg_printf(
  201. conn,
  202. "<div id='websock_text_field'>No websocket connection yet</div>\n");
  203. #else
  204. mg_printf(conn, "</head>\n<body>\n");
  205. mg_printf(conn, "Example not compiled with USE_WEBSOCKET\n");
  206. #endif
  207. mg_printf(conn, "</body>\n</html>\n");
  208. return 1;
  209. }
  210.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  211. /* MAX_WS_CLIENTS defines how many clients can connect to a websocket at the
  212. * same time. The value 5 is very small and used here only for demonstration;
  213. * it can be easily tested to connect more than MAX_WS_CLIENTS clients.
  214. * A real server should use a much higher number, or better use a dynamic list
  215. * of currently connected websocket clients. */
  216. #define MAX_WS_CLIENTS (5)
  217. struct t_ws_client {
  218. struct mg_connection *conn;
  219. int state;
  220. } static ws_clients[MAX_WS_CLIENTS];
  221. #define ASSERT(x) \
  222. { \
  223. if (!(x)) { \
  224. fprintf(stderr, \
  225. "Assertion failed in line %u\n", \
  226. (unsigned)__LINE__); \
  227. } \
  228. }
  229. int
  230. WebSocketConnectHandler(const stru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  231. {
  232. struct mg_context *ctx = mg_get_context(conn);
  233. int reject = 1;
  234. int i;
  235. mg_lock_context(ctx);
  236. for (i = 0; i < MAX_WS_CLIENTS; i++) {
  237. if (ws_clients[i].conn == NULL) {
  238. ws_clients[i].conn = (struct mg_connection *)conn;
  239. ws_clients[i].state = 1;
  240. mg_set_user_connection_data(conn, (void *)(ws_clients + i));
  241. reject = 0;
  242. break;
  243. }
  244. }
  245. mg_unlock_context(ctx);
  246. fprintf(stdout,
  247. "Websocket client %s\r\n\r\n",
  248. (reject ? "rejected" : "accepted"));
  249. return reject;
  250. }
  251. void
  252. WebSocketReadyHandler(stru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  253. {
  254. const char *text = "Hello from the websocket ready handler";
  255. struct t_ws_client *client = mg_get_user_connection_data(conn);
  256. mg_websocket_write(conn, WEBSOCKET_OPCODE_TEXT, text, strlen(text));
  257. fprintf(stdout, "Greeting message sent to websocket client\r\n\r\n");
  258. ASSERT(client->conn == conn);
  259. ASSERT(client->state == 1);
  260. client->state = 2;
  261. }
  262. int
  263. WebsocketDataHandler(struct mg_connection *conn,
  264. int bits,
  265. char *data,
  266. size_t len,
  267. void *cbdata)
  268. {
  269. struct t_ws_client *client = mg_get_user_connection_data(conn);
  270. ASSERT(client->conn == conn);
  271. ASSERT(client->state >= 1);
  272. fprintf(stdout, "Websocket got data:\r\n");
  273. fwrite(data, len, 1, stdout);
  274. fprintf(stdout, "\r\n\r\n");
  275. return 1;
  276. }
  277. void
  278. WebSocketCloseHandler(const struct mg_connection *conn, void *cbdata)
  279. {
  280. struct mg_context *ctx = mg_get_context(conn);
  281. struct t_ws_client *client = mg_get_user_connection_data(conn);
  282. ASSERT(client->conn == conn);
  283. ASSERT(client->state >= 1);
  284. mg_lock_context(ctx);
  285. client->state = 0;
  286. client->conn = NULL;
  287. mg_unlock_context(ctx);
  288. fprintf(stdout,
  289. "Client droped from the set of webserver connections\r\n\r\n");
  290. }
  291. void
  292. InformWebsockets(struct mg_context *ctx)
  293. {
  294. static unsigned long cnt = 0;
  295. char text[32];
  296. int i;
  297. sprintf(text, "%lu", ++cnt);
  298. mg_lock_context(ctx);
  299. for (i = 0; i < MAX_WS_CLIENTS; i++) {
  300. if (ws_clients[i].state == 2) {
  301. mg_websocket_write(ws_clients[i].conn,
  302. WEBSOCKET_OPCODE_TEXT,
  303. text,
  304. strlen(text));
  305. }
  306. }
  307. mg_unlock_context(ctx);
  308. }
  309. #endif
  310. int
  311. main(int argc, char *argv[])
  312. {
  313. const char *options[] = {"document_root",
  314. DOCUMENT_ROOT,
  315. "listening_ports",
  316. PORT,
  317. "request_timeout_ms",
  318. "10000",
  319. "error_log_file",
  320. "error.log",
  321.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  322. "websocket_timeout_ms",
  323. "3600000",
  324. #endif
  325. #ifndef NO_SSL
  326. "ssl_certificate",
  327. "../../resources/cert/server.pem",
  328. #endif
  329. 0};
  330. struct mg_callbacks callbacks;
  331. struct mg_context *ctx;
  332. struct mg_server_ports ports[32];
  333. int port_cnt, n;
  334. int err = 0;
  335. /* Check if libcivetweb has been built with all required features. */
  336. #ifdef USE_IPV6
  337. if (!mg_check_feature(8)) {
  338. fprintf(stderr,
  339. "Error: Embedded example built with IPv6 support, "
  340. "but civetweb library build without.\n");
  341. err = 1;
  342. }
  343. #endif
  344.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  345. if (!mg_check_feature(16)) {
  346. fprintf(stderr,
  347. "Error: Embedded example built with websocket support, "
  348. "but civetweb library build without.\n");
  349. err = 1;
  350. }
  351. #endif
  352. #ifndef NO_SSL
  353. if (!mg_check_feature(2)) {
  354. fprintf(stderr,
  355. "Error: Embedded example built with SSL support, "
  356. "but civetweb library build without.\n");
  357. err = 1;
  358. }
  359. #endif
  360. if (err) {
  361. fprintf(stderr, "Cannot start CivetWeb - inconsistent build.\n");
  362. return EXIT_FAILURE;
  363. }
  364. /* Start CivetWeb web server */
  365. memset(&callbacks, 0, sizeof(callbacks));
  366. ctx = mg_start(&callbacks, 0, options);
  367. /* Add handler EXAMPLE_URI, to explain the example */
  368.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, EXAMPLE_URI, ExampleHandler, 0);
  369.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, EXIT_URI, ExitHandler, 0);
  370. /* Add handler for /A* and special handler for /A/B */
  371.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/A", AHandler, 0);
  372.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/A/B", ABHandler, 0);
  373. /* Add handler for /B, /B/A, /B/B but not for /B* */
  374.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/B$", BXHandler, (void *)0);
  375.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/B/A$", BXHandler, (void *)1);
  376.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/B/B$", BXHandler, (void *)2);
  377. /* Add handler for all files with .foo extention */
  378.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"**.foo$", FooHandler, 0);
  379. /* Add handler for /form (serve a file outside the document root) */
  380. mg_set_request_handler(ctx,
  381. "/form",
  382. FileHandler,
  383. (void *)"../../test/form.html");
  384. /* Add handler for form data */
  385. mg_set_request_handler(ctx,
  386. "/handle_form.embedded_c.example.callback",
  387. FormHandler,
  388. (void *)0);
  389. /* Add HTTP site to open a websocket connection */
  390. mg_set_request_handler(ctx, "/websocket", WebSocketStartHandler, 0);
  391.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  392. /* WS site for the websocket connection */
  393. mg_set_websocket_handler(ctx,
  394. "/websocket",
  395. WebSocketConnectHandler,
  396. WebSocketReadyHandler,
  397. WebsocketDataHandler,
  398. WebSocketCloseHandler,
  399. 0);
  400. #endif
  401. /* List all listening ports */
  402. memset(ports, 0, sizeof(ports));
  403. port_cnt = mg_get_server_ports(ctx, 32, ports);
  404. printf("\n%i listening ports:\n\n", port_cnt);
  405. for (n = 0; n < port_cnt && n < 32; n++) {
  406. const char *proto = ports[n].is_ssl ? "https" : "http";
  407. const char *host;
  408. if ((ports[n].protocol & 1) == 1) {
  409. /* IPv4 */
  410. host = "127.0.0.1";
  411. printf("Browse files at %s://%s:%i/\n", proto, host, ports[n].port);
  412. printf("Run example at %s://%s:%i%s\n",
  413. proto,
  414. host,
  415. ports[n].port,
  416. EXAMPLE_URI);
  417. printf(
  418. "Exit at %s://%s:%i%s\n", proto, host, ports[n].port, EXIT_URI);
  419. printf("\n");
  420. }
  421. if ((ports[n].protocol & 2) == 2) {
  422. /* IPv6 */
  423. host = "[::1]";
  424. printf("Browse files at %s://%s:%i/\n", proto, host, ports[n].port);
  425. printf("Run example at %s://%s:%i%s\n",
  426. proto,
  427. host,
  428. ports[n].port,
  429. EXAMPLE_URI);
  430. printf(
  431. "Exit at %s://%s:%i%s\n", proto, host, ports[n].port, EXIT_URI);
  432. printf("\n");
  433. }
  434. }
  435. /* Wait until the server should be closed */
  436. while (!exitNow) {
  437. #ifdef _WIN32
  438. Sleep(1000);
  439. #else
  440. sleep(1);
  441. #endif
  442. #ifdef USE_WEBSOCKET
  443. InformWebsockets(ctx);
  444. #endif
  445. }
  446. /* Stop the server */
  447. mg_stop(ctx);
  448. printf("Server stopped.\n");
  449. printf("Bye!\n");
  450. return EXIT_SUCCESS;
